The file VMIXCODECLIBRARY.dll is a dynamic link library (DLL) developed by vMix (StudioCoast Pty Ltd). It is a core component used by vMix, a popular live video production and streaming software. This file contains the essential instructions and "codecs" that allow vMix to compress, decompress, and process various video and audio formats in real-time. VMIXCODECLIBRARY.dll
